The Sacred shows up in many forms. Sometimes we can articulate what we know, sometimes not. Are you ready to honor the holy as it is revealed in body, mind, heart, and spirit? To see Spirit in others? To make an offering of your part of the story?

Cynthia Winton-Henry, cofounder of InterPlay, offers practices and ideas to unlock the wisdom of body and soul. Learn the secrets of embodiment in presentations, creative experiences, and reflection. Journey into the five arenas of universal body wisdom: movement, voice, word, stillness, and connection.

In this Spirithouse there is room for faith and no faith, the simple and extraordinary, the recognizable and mysterious, the contemplative and flamboyant, the funny and sad.

Friday night: Rebuilding the Spirit House: Body Mind Heart Spirit Stories

In the United States we see that we are cut off from ancestral dances, songs and oral histories. We don't trust our bodies or the earth body. Even though every religious tradition carries deep body wisdom, we struggle to practice it. We need to rebuild from the ground up, nourish our roots and trunk, our body and soul. Cynthia shares fragments of her own story captured in her book Chasing the Dance of Life: A Faith Story, shares the cornerstone idea of InterPlay, and offers simple practices to receive and share the sacred.

Saturday: Sacred Story-telling: Does You Body Have Something to Say?

Tour the house of many forms and many Wisdoms: Movement, Voice and Breath, Words, Contact, Stillness. See what your bodyspirit is ready to offer.

Cynthia Winton-Henry, co-founder of InterPlay with Phil Porter, has researched "what the body wants" in the arts, in jails, shelters, slums, hospitals, churches, businesses, classrooms, doctoral programs in theology and the arts, and in multicultural education. She develops somatic curriculums to address racism, leadership for the Earth, and spiritual intelligence with an eye to supporting millennials. A featured speaker on the Body Intelligence Summit and a keynoter at conferences, Cynthia is the author of What the Body Wants, Having It All: Body, Mind, Heart & Spirit Together Again at Last; Dance - A Sacred Art: Discovering the Joy of Movement as Spiritual Practice, Chasing the Dance of Life: A Faith Journey, and The Art of Ensoulment: A Playbook on How to Create From Body and Soul..
